The Big Picture
Drew Gooden's video delivers a verdict on the troubled state of the music industry—hinged on the exploitation by music streaming giant Spotify and the invasive rise of AI-generated music. He reveals the dissonance between a booming top-tier revenue and artists at the grassroot levels struggling to survive. Despite hurdles, Drew offers a glimmer of hope: creating music out of pure passion and engaging with local, intimate music scenes instead of getting caught up in industry woes. 🎤✨
